My video card was the last part to arrive and did so today. Prior to its arrival i installed windows etc. Now i have installed the graphics card and connected my HDMI cable to it, my resolution has reduced significantly. I turned it off and on but all this did was make the screen smaller. The resolution is better but now there is a black border around my screen. What should i do?

Go to advanced mode of the Catalyst Control center. Under HDMI tab, adjust the scaling option to get rid of the black bars.
